Output c37524e54fbf1f683a6cbbf9538214e8f402f6dcb5dba9065133d74f22ae0db3:13

value
2632498
script pubkey
OP_0 OP_PUSHBYTES_20 b1a2a3d920c51431c64862ab0c1be59cf302405e
address
bc1qkx328kfqc52rr3jgv24scxl9nnesysz7tuhakd
transaction
c37524e54fbf1f683a6cbbf9538214e8f402f6dcb5dba9065133d74f22ae0db3
confirmations
186575
spent
true